1)      Vastu for Elevation of the building:

    There should not be cross signs anywhere in the elevation.

    Signs of question mark should not be there.

    White and cream colour are best for external elevation. Don’t use

    Black colour for elevation.

    If the house is south facing then try to use red or maroon colour in  

    Elevation for some elements.

                        Use tinted glass for south facing windows.

                       Use heavy curtains for windows in south.

                       Make the south taller as much as possible.

2)     Vastu for doorbell

      Keep the doorbell in southeast.

Prefer bell sound is that of Gayatri or some auspicious religious

                   Mantra.

                   Fix the switch the bell on the right side of the main entrance door.

                   Sound of birds chirping, koyal or cuckoo should be fixed on

                   Northwest Of the inside wall.  Don’t fix the inside doorbell on

                   Northeast or southwest corner of the house.

                   Keep the doorbell away from Pooja sthan to avoid disturbance.

                   Use the doorbell which gives soothing sound and not a harsh one.

                   See that rainwater should not enter the front door switch.

3)        Use of camphor in Vastu

Camphor creates positive energy and hence is used in vastu to remove negative energies.

Keep the camphor on the right and left side of the main door inside the house in an open bowl.

Keep the camphor in the bedroom if you feel suffocated or uneasy.

Use the camphor in morning times and not at night.

Place the camphor in the bedroom of the married couple to harmonize their relationship.

Place some camphor in the shoe rack to remove negative energy.

If there is some vastu dosh in Brahmasthan then place some camphor in the Barhmasthan in a non-metallic plate.

4)     Vastu for main gate

a)      W/9=ax2, leave this space from the end of the boundary and the fix your main gate. It means divide the front length w into nine parts and then leave two spaces from the boundary and then fix your main gate.

b)     Main gate should be clean and well maintained.

c)      Same formula is applicable for the main entrance of the house.

d)     Normally as per society rules the main gate needs to be installed in the corner of the boundary but you can fix your main entrance of the house as per the formula explained in “a “above.
